Subject: Handover — Spindlecab Rebalancer DB

Hi Orla,

Handing over the Spindlecab rebalancing tool before your review. It reads dock occupancy every five minutes and writes move suggestions to a single schema. Access is read-mostly; the writer role is scoped tightly. For your audit session, use the connection string below.

primary connection of tajeg-tajop = postgresql://julax_svc:DI@db-e7f3.kelvidyn.corp:5432/rusdor

## Service Accounts — Crumbline Order Cutoff

The `svc-cutoff-enforcer` account applies the 14:00 order-cutoff rule for Crumbline's wholesale bakery clients. It holds read-only access to the order queue and write access only to the cutoff-flag field. All calls are logged to the audit stream and reviewed quarterly. The account authenticates to the internal scheduling service using the key below.

API key for tagef-fafop: vxb2-ta

**Vendor note: Inkmill markdown pipeline**

Rendering for Parchway docs is outsourced to Inkmill under an annual contract, renewing each March. They handle sanitization and PDF export; we own the upload queue. SLA: 4-hour response on rendering failures. Escalate only after two failed retries. Their support desk is reachable at the address below.

billing contact of hahaf-baguf = zorael.tammir.jorius@sivrelhq.internal

Subject: Sealed exam papers — Thornbury Institute

Dispatch desk,

The records team has sealed this term's exam papers in the numbered canvas pouch. Seals are logged and photographed. The pouch must not be opened in transit under any circumstances. Please brief the assigned courier carefully and ensure the hand-over follows the instruction below.

courier memo of yawep-yafog: the pramir ulaix courier leaves the ulavan aldix frair zorok oliiel joreth rusdor fenvan ledger at gate 1305 under passcode 514738